David de Gea is a Spanish professional footballer who is widely regarded as one of the best goalkeepers in the world. Born on November 7, 1990, in Madrid, Spain, de Gea began his football journey at a young age and quickly showed immense talent and potential.
De Gea's professional career began at Atletico Madrid, where he joined the youth academy at the age of He progressed through the ranks and made his first-team debut in 2009 at the age of 18. His performances were impressive, showcasing his agility, reflexes, and shot-stopping abilities. De Gea played a crucial role in Atletico Madrid's success, helping the team win the UEFA Europa League in 2010 and the UEFA Super Cup in 2010 and 2012.
In 2011, de Gea made a high-profile move to English giants Manchester United. Initially, he faced criticism and skepticism due to his young age and lack of experience in English football. However, he quickly proved his worth and silenced his doubters with his exceptional performances. De Gea's agility and lightning-fast reflexes became his trademarks, allowing him to make numerous acrobatic saves and deny opposition players from scoring.
De Gea's shot-stopping abilities have been crucial for Manchester United over the years. His incredible saves have often rescued his team from difficult situations and earned them valuable points. His performances have earned him numerous accolades, including the Sir Matt Busby Player of the Year award, which he has won multiple times. De Gea has also been named in the PFA Team of the Year on several occasions, highlighting his consistency and impact on the game.
